Max Verstappen takes second career pole position in Brazil!

Max Verstappen has taken the second pole position of his career on Saturday afternoon at Interlagos, beating Sebastian Vettel to the top spot ahead of Sunday's Brazilian Grand Prix. Verstappen, who had never qualified within the top three before today at Interlagos, was quickest in all three sessions of qualifying as well as FP3 earlier on Saturday. Charles Leclerc did clock the fourth-best time in Q3 but will drop 10 places due to a grid penalty for swapping out his engine, meaning third-placed Lewis Hamilton will be joined by his teammate Valtteri Bottas on the second row of the grid.
